# Break-Glass: Catalog Cache Invalidation

Scope: the Pinrow product catalog at Veldstone Retail. If stale prices persist after a purge and the Hollowmere invalidation queue is wedged, use break-glass to flush the edge tier directly. Contractors: get verbal sign-off from the catalog lead first. Steps: open the Hollowmere admin shell, select emergency-flush, confirm the tenant, and run it once — repeated flushes thrash the origin. Access is logged and expires after 20 minutes. Unseal the admin shell with the passphrase below.

recovery phrase for kahop-tajog: istix-casvan

Handover: FX rounding in Coinlace plugins. Known issue — half-even rounding applied twice when converters chain, off by one minor unit on JPY and KRW pairs. Fix is pending in core; meanwhile, round only at the final display step. Test vectors and the interim rounding spec live on the internal page.

dashboard of kafof-tahaf = https://confluence.tolvaqsys.internal/projects/browse/display/a1250987

Subject: Heads up — Payvane export format change

Hi folks,

Quick note before next week's release: the Payvane payroll export is moving from pipe-delimited to JSON Lines. Field names stay the same, but timestamps switch to UTC. Your plugins should parse both formats during the transition window. We've set up a sandbox feed so you can test early. Authenticate your sandbox requests with the token below.

session JWT of yawep-yawep = eyJhbGciOiJIUzI1NiIsInR5cCI6IkpXVCJ9.eyJzdWIiOiI3pWF3_In0.aXYsHiog